Premier David Eby has issued the following statement marking Bandi Chhor Divas:
“Sikhs in British Columbia and around the world are celebrating Bandi Chhor Divas.
“This day commemorates the stand taken by the sixth Guru, Guru Hargobind Sahib Ji, who refused to accept his release from prison unless 52 unfairly imprisoned others were also freed. His act of selflessness and generosity continues to inspire Sikhs more than four centuries later.
“Bandi Chhor Divas is a time of spiritual reflection, marked by prayers and the reading of hymns from the Guru Granth Sahib, the Sikh holy book. To celebrate this day, homes and gurdwaras will be illuminated by lamps and candles. Families and friends will gather to share sweets and festive meals.
